The Warrick County Solid Waste Board held a meeting on August 20, 2026, focusing on several procurement and contract-related matters. Key discussions included approval of claims such as a $36,449.50 payment to Sims Electric and a $5,200 payment to Guide Corneling. The board approved a lease renewal with a $1,000 annual increase, totaling $26,000 over five years, with a clause allowing dissolution upon 150 days' notice. They reviewed and approved a $22,170 quote from Intech Environmental Services LLC for a paint disposal event scheduled for September 26, 2026, with a spending cap of $70,000. Additionally, the board approved a proposed rate increase from Renewable for waste hauling services after analysis showed it remained cost-effective compared to self-hauling. The board also authorized sending a commercial collection addendum to Renewable, establishing pricing based on tonnage and material type. Finally, they approved surplus of an old baler via gov.com and discussed upcoming electrical work involving Sims Electric and Centerpoint.
